~madteam/mg5amcnlo/series2.0

« back to all changes in this revision

Viewing changes to tests/input_files/IOTestsComparison/long_ML_SMQCD_optimized/gg_wmtbx/mp_helas_calls_uvct_1.f

  • Committer: olivier Mattelaer
  • Date: 2015-03-05 00:14:16 UTC
  • mfrom: (258.1.9 2.3)
  • mto: (258.8.1 2.3)
  • mto: This revision was merged to the branch mainline in revision 259.
  • Revision ID: olivier.mattelaer@uclouvain.be-20150305001416-y9mzeykfzwnl9t0j
partial merge

Show diffs side-by-side

added added

removed removed

Lines of Context:
4
4
C     
5
5
C     CONSTANTS
6
6
C     
7
 
      INTEGER NBORNAMPS
8
 
      PARAMETER (NBORNAMPS=8)
9
7
      INTEGER    NEXTERNAL
10
8
      PARAMETER (NEXTERNAL=5)
11
9
      INTEGER    NCOMB
12
10
      PARAMETER (NCOMB=48)
 
11
 
 
12
      INTEGER NBORNAMPS
 
13
      PARAMETER (NBORNAMPS=8)
13
14
      INTEGER    NLOOPS, NLOOPGROUPS, NCTAMPS
14
 
      PARAMETER (NLOOPS=162, NLOOPGROUPS=77, NCTAMPS=252)
 
15
      PARAMETER (NLOOPS=144, NLOOPGROUPS=77, NCTAMPS=252)
 
16
      INTEGER    NLOOPAMPS
 
17
      PARAMETER (NLOOPAMPS=396)
15
18
      INTEGER    NWAVEFUNCS,NLOOPWAVEFUNCS
16
 
      PARAMETER (NWAVEFUNCS=28,NLOOPWAVEFUNCS=300)
 
19
      PARAMETER (NWAVEFUNCS=28,NLOOPWAVEFUNCS=267)
17
20
      INTEGER MAXLWFSIZE
18
21
      PARAMETER (MAXLWFSIZE=4)
19
22
      INTEGER LOOPMAXCOEFS, VERTEXMAXCOEFS
65
68
      COMPLEX*32 PL(0:3,0:NLOOPWAVEFUNCS)
66
69
      COMMON/ML5_0_MP_WL/WL,PL
67
70
 
68
 
      COMPLEX*32 LOOPCOEFS(0:LOOPMAXCOEFS-1,NSQUAREDSO,NLOOPGROUPS)
69
 
      COMMON/ML5_0_MP_LCOEFS/LOOPCOEFS
70
 
 
71
71
      COMPLEX*32 AMPL(3,NCTAMPS)
72
72
      COMMON/ML5_0_MP_AMPL/AMPL
73
73
 
74
 
      COMPLEX*16 LOOPRES(3,NSQUAREDSO,NLOOPGROUPS)
75
 
      LOGICAL S(NSQUAREDSO,NLOOPGROUPS)
76
 
      COMMON/ML5_0_LOOPRES/LOOPRES,S
77
74
C     
78
75
C     ----------
79
76
C     BEGIN CODE
85
82
        GOTO 1001
86
83
      ENDIF
87
84
 
88
 
C     Amplitude(s) for UVCT diagram with ID 153
 
85
C     Amplitude(s) for UVCT diagram with ID 135
89
86
      CALL MP_FFV1_0(W(1,5),W(1,7),W(1,6),GC_5,AMPL(1,237))
90
87
      AMPL(1,237)=AMPL(1,237)*(2.0D0*UVWFCT_G_2+2.0D0*UVWFCT_G_1
91
88
     $ +1.0D0*UVWFCT_T_0+1.0D0*UVWFCT_B_0)
92
 
C     Amplitude(s) for UVCT diagram with ID 154
 
89
C     Amplitude(s) for UVCT diagram with ID 136
93
90
      CALL MP_FFV1_0(W(1,5),W(1,7),W(1,6),GC_5,AMPL(2,238))
94
91
      AMPL(2,238)=AMPL(2,238)*(2.0D0*UVWFCT_B_0_1EPS+4.0D0*UVWFCT_G_2_1
95
92
     $ EPS)
96
 
C     Amplitude(s) for UVCT diagram with ID 155
 
93
C     Amplitude(s) for UVCT diagram with ID 137
97
94
      CALL MP_FFV1_0(W(1,8),W(1,4),W(1,6),GC_5,AMPL(1,239))
98
95
      AMPL(1,239)=AMPL(1,239)*(2.0D0*UVWFCT_G_2+2.0D0*UVWFCT_G_1
99
96
     $ +1.0D0*UVWFCT_T_0+1.0D0*UVWFCT_B_0)
100
 
C     Amplitude(s) for UVCT diagram with ID 156
 
97
C     Amplitude(s) for UVCT diagram with ID 138
101
98
      CALL MP_FFV1_0(W(1,8),W(1,4),W(1,6),GC_5,AMPL(2,240))
102
99
      AMPL(2,240)=AMPL(2,240)*(2.0D0*UVWFCT_B_0_1EPS+4.0D0*UVWFCT_G_2_1
103
100
     $ EPS)
104
 
C     Amplitude(s) for UVCT diagram with ID 157
 
101
C     Amplitude(s) for UVCT diagram with ID 139
105
102
      CALL MP_FFV2_0(W(1,10),W(1,9),W(1,3),GC_47,AMPL(1,241))
106
103
      AMPL(1,241)=AMPL(1,241)*(2.0D0*UVWFCT_G_2+2.0D0*UVWFCT_G_1
107
104
     $ +1.0D0*UVWFCT_T_0+1.0D0*UVWFCT_B_0)
108
 
C     Amplitude(s) for UVCT diagram with ID 158
 
105
C     Amplitude(s) for UVCT diagram with ID 140
109
106
      CALL MP_FFV2_0(W(1,10),W(1,9),W(1,3),GC_47,AMPL(2,242))
110
107
      AMPL(2,242)=AMPL(2,242)*(2.0D0*UVWFCT_B_0_1EPS+4.0D0*UVWFCT_G_2_1
111
108
     $ EPS)
112
 
C     Amplitude(s) for UVCT diagram with ID 159
 
109
C     Amplitude(s) for UVCT diagram with ID 141
113
110
      CALL MP_FFV1_0(W(1,8),W(1,9),W(1,2),GC_5,AMPL(1,243))
114
111
      AMPL(1,243)=AMPL(1,243)*(2.0D0*UVWFCT_G_2+2.0D0*UVWFCT_G_1
115
112
     $ +1.0D0*UVWFCT_T_0+1.0D0*UVWFCT_B_0)
116
 
C     Amplitude(s) for UVCT diagram with ID 160
 
113
C     Amplitude(s) for UVCT diagram with ID 142
117
114
      CALL MP_FFV1_0(W(1,8),W(1,9),W(1,2),GC_5,AMPL(2,244))
118
115
      AMPL(2,244)=AMPL(2,244)*(2.0D0*UVWFCT_B_0_1EPS+4.0D0*UVWFCT_G_2_1
119
116
     $ EPS)
120
 
C     Amplitude(s) for UVCT diagram with ID 161
 
117
C     Amplitude(s) for UVCT diagram with ID 143
121
118
      CALL MP_FFV2_0(W(1,11),W(1,12),W(1,3),GC_47,AMPL(1,245))
122
119
      AMPL(1,245)=AMPL(1,245)*(2.0D0*UVWFCT_G_2+2.0D0*UVWFCT_G_1
123
120
     $ +1.0D0*UVWFCT_T_0+1.0D0*UVWFCT_B_0)
124
 
C     Amplitude(s) for UVCT diagram with ID 162
 
121
C     Amplitude(s) for UVCT diagram with ID 144
125
122
      CALL MP_FFV2_0(W(1,11),W(1,12),W(1,3),GC_47,AMPL(2,246))
126
123
      AMPL(2,246)=AMPL(2,246)*(2.0D0*UVWFCT_B_0_1EPS+4.0D0*UVWFCT_G_2_1
127
124
     $ EPS)
128
 
C     Amplitude(s) for UVCT diagram with ID 163
 
125
C     Amplitude(s) for UVCT diagram with ID 145
129
126
      CALL MP_FFV1_0(W(1,11),W(1,7),W(1,2),GC_5,AMPL(1,247))
130
127
      AMPL(1,247)=AMPL(1,247)*(2.0D0*UVWFCT_G_2+2.0D0*UVWFCT_G_1
131
128
     $ +1.0D0*UVWFCT_T_0+1.0D0*UVWFCT_B_0)
132
 
C     Amplitude(s) for UVCT diagram with ID 164
 
129
C     Amplitude(s) for UVCT diagram with ID 146
133
130
      CALL MP_FFV1_0(W(1,11),W(1,7),W(1,2),GC_5,AMPL(2,248))
134
131
      AMPL(2,248)=AMPL(2,248)*(2.0D0*UVWFCT_B_0_1EPS+4.0D0*UVWFCT_G_2_1
135
132
     $ EPS)
136
 
C     Amplitude(s) for UVCT diagram with ID 165
 
133
C     Amplitude(s) for UVCT diagram with ID 147
137
134
      CALL MP_FFV1_0(W(1,8),W(1,12),W(1,1),GC_5,AMPL(1,249))
138
135
      AMPL(1,249)=AMPL(1,249)*(2.0D0*UVWFCT_G_2+2.0D0*UVWFCT_G_1
139
136
     $ +1.0D0*UVWFCT_T_0+1.0D0*UVWFCT_B_0)
140
 
C     Amplitude(s) for UVCT diagram with ID 166
 
137
C     Amplitude(s) for UVCT diagram with ID 148
141
138
      CALL MP_FFV1_0(W(1,8),W(1,12),W(1,1),GC_5,AMPL(2,250))
142
139
      AMPL(2,250)=AMPL(2,250)*(2.0D0*UVWFCT_B_0_1EPS+4.0D0*UVWFCT_G_2_1
143
140
     $ EPS)
144
 
C     Amplitude(s) for UVCT diagram with ID 167
 
141
C     Amplitude(s) for UVCT diagram with ID 149
145
142
      CALL MP_FFV1_0(W(1,10),W(1,7),W(1,1),GC_5,AMPL(1,251))
146
143
      AMPL(1,251)=AMPL(1,251)*(2.0D0*UVWFCT_G_2+2.0D0*UVWFCT_G_1
147
144
     $ +1.0D0*UVWFCT_T_0+1.0D0*UVWFCT_B_0)
148
 
C     Amplitude(s) for UVCT diagram with ID 168
 
145
C     Amplitude(s) for UVCT diagram with ID 150
149
146
      CALL MP_FFV1_0(W(1,10),W(1,7),W(1,1),GC_5,AMPL(2,252))
150
147
      AMPL(2,252)=AMPL(2,252)*(2.0D0*UVWFCT_B_0_1EPS+4.0D0*UVWFCT_G_2_1
151
148
     $ EPS)